Businesses in nearly 70% of New Mexico’s counties can operate with limited Covid-19 restrictions, according to Department of Health data released Wednesday afternoon.
Under New Mexico’s framework for lifting Covid-19 restrictions, 13 counties are in the Turquoise Tier. They are Catron, De Baca, Hidalgo, Lea, Los Alamos, McKinley, Quay, Roosevelt, San Juan, Santa Fe, Sierra, Socorro and Union counties.
